The IT market in Vietnam is quite new, however, it has seen a rapid development. Even though the country connected to the internet in 1997, by the end of 2001, the subscriber numbers were assessed at approximately 165,000. One year later, after a price reduction, the user numbers increased to more than one million. …
The Vietnam tobacco industry has a production capacity of approximately 5,800 million packs per year, which is used at around 70% to 80% of its capacity. The cigarette output of the sector has been rising since 2000, mainly because of investments which were made in the tobacco growth, processing and production equipment,…
